Preventing Yellow Leaves

🌊 Best Practices for Watering

Watering your Fire Meidiland roses correctly is crucial. Aim to water deeply but infrequently, allowing the roots to reach for moisture.

Using drip irrigation or soaker hoses can be a game-changer. These methods minimize leaf wetness, reducing the risk of fungal diseases.

πŸ“… Fertilization Schedule

Timing is everything when it comes to fertilization. Apply slow-release fertilizers tailored for roses in early spring and mid-summer for optimal growth.

Choosing the right product can make a significant difference. Look for fertilizers that provide balanced nutrients to support your roses throughout the growing season.

🌱 Soil Health and Amendments

Healthy soil is the foundation of vibrant roses. Aim for a soil pH between 6.0 and 6.8 to create the ideal environment for your plants.

Incorporating organic matter, compost, and sulfur can help adjust pH levels. These amendments not only improve soil quality but also enhance nutrient availability.

πŸ” Regular Inspection and Maintenance

Regular checks can save your roses from potential issues. Inspect your plants weekly for pests and diseases to catch problems early.

Pruning is equally important. Removing dead or yellowing leaves promotes better air circulation, helping your roses thrive.

Treating Yellow Leaves

Step-by-Step Treatment for Nutrient Deficiencies 🌱

Identifying nutrient deficiencies is crucial for the health of your Fire Meidiland roses. Start by determining whether the issue is due to nitrogen or iron deficiency.

Once identified, choose an appropriate fertilizer tailored to the specific deficiency. Always apply according to package instructions to avoid over-fertilization, which can cause more harm than good.

How to Adjust Watering Practices πŸ’§

Assessing your current watering schedule is the first step in correcting yellow leaves. Look at both the frequency and the amount of water you're providing.

Next, modify your approach based on soil moisture readings. If the soil is too dry or too wet, adjust accordingly. Implement a consistent routine, and consider using reminders via the Greg plant care app to keep you on track.

Pest Control Methods πŸ›

Pests can be a significant factor in yellowing leaves. Start with organic options like neem oil or insecticidal soap, which are effective and environmentally friendly.

If the infestation persists, consider chemical treatments. Always follow application guidelines to ensure safety and effectiveness.

Fungal Disease Treatments πŸ„

Fungal diseases can wreak havoc on your roses. Begin by identifying the specific issue, such as powdery mildew or black spot.

Once identified, apply fungicides according to label instructions for the best results. Additionally, improve air circulation and reduce humidity around your plants to help prevent future outbreaks.

Seasonal Considerations

🌸 Spring Care Tips

Spring is the perfect time to rejuvenate your Fire Meidiland roses. Start with balanced nutrients to give them a strong foundation for growth.

Pruning is equally important; remove any dead or damaged wood to encourage new blooms and improve air circulation.

β˜€οΈ Summer Care Tips

As temperatures rise, your roses will need more attention. Increase watering frequency during hot spells to keep them hydrated and thriving.

Regularly monitor for pests, as summer can bring unwanted visitors. Early detection is key to maintaining healthy plants.

πŸ‚ Fall Care Tips

As the growing season winds down, it's time to prepare your roses for dormancy. Reduce watering and stop fertilizing to help them transition smoothly.

Mulching is essential during this time. It protects the roots from harsh winter temperatures and retains soil moisture.

❄️ Winter Preparation

Winter preparation is crucial for the health of your roses. Prune back to promote healthy growth come spring, ensuring your plants are ready to flourish.

Cover the base with mulch to insulate the roots. This simple step can make a significant difference in their survival through the colder months.
